Performance of Recycled Aggregate Concrete-Filled Steel Tubular Members under Various Loadings

摘要:The technology of re-using waste concrete resources and replacing natural aggregates with recycled aggregate concrete (RAC), can effectively make use of the waste concrete resources as new building aggregates, save the natural coarse and fine aggregates, and protect the environment RAC-filled steel tube (RACFST) can protect RAC with the confinement of the outer steel tube, and the interaction between the steel tube and core RAC exists This is propitious for improving the mechanical performance of RAC In this paper, the results of experimental and theoretical studies of circular and square RAC-filled steel tubular (RACFST) members under various loadings are presented, and the members are subjected to short-term loadings, long-term sustained loads and cyclic flexural loadings Two numerical methods, including fibre model method (FMM) and finite element method (FEM), are established to investigate the performance of RACFST members under various loadings The results in this paper may be taken as reference in related research
